Отправил в личку, у меня улов не большой
шустрый скрипт скрипт зеркала NOD32
Правила форума
Убедительная просьба юзать теги [code] при оформлении листингов.
Сообщения не оформленные должным образом имеют все шансы быть незамеченными.
Убедительная просьба юзать теги [code] при оформлении листингов.
Сообщения не оформленные должным образом имеют все шансы быть незамеченными.
-
yoda
- ефрейтор
- Сообщения: 55
- Зарегистрирован: 2023-07-29 9:04:00
шустрый скрипт скрипт зеркала NOD32
Услуги хостинговой компании Host-Food.ru
Тарифы на хостинг в России, от 12 рублей: https://www.host-food.ru/tariffs/hosting/
Тарифы на виртуальные сервера (VPS/VDS/KVM) в РФ, от 189 руб.: https://www.host-food.ru/tariffs/virtualny-server-vps/
Выделенные сервера, Россия, Москва, от 2000 рублей (HP Proliant G5, Intel Xeon E5430 (2.66GHz, Quad-Core, 12Mb), 8Gb RAM, 2x300Gb SAS HDD, P400i, 512Mb, BBU):
https://www.host-food.ru/tariffs/vydelennyi-server-ds/
Недорогие домены в популярных зонах: https://www.host-food.ru/domains/
Тарифы на виртуальные сервера (VPS/VDS/KVM) в РФ, от 189 руб.: https://www.host-food.ru/tariffs/virtualny-server-vps/
Выделенные сервера, Россия, Москва, от 2000 рублей (HP Proliant G5, Intel Xeon E5430 (2.66GHz, Quad-Core, 12Mb), 8Gb RAM, 2x300Gb SAS HDD, P400i, 512Mb, BBU):
https://www.host-food.ru/tariffs/vydelennyi-server-ds/
Недорогие домены в популярных зонах: https://www.host-food.ru/domains/
-
depositaire
- сержант
- Сообщения: 202
- Зарегистрирован: 2011-10-14 14:04:17
-
depositaire
- сержант
- Сообщения: 202
- Зарегистрирован: 2011-10-14 14:04:17
шустрый скрипт скрипт зеркала NOD32
Выкладываю перелопаченный скрипт от уважаемого scorp337150. Переделывал в основном под себя и свои хотелки. В итоге за несколько месяцев переделан почти весь. Со старым скриптом с Git не совместим от слова совсем. Проверил работу на Винде и Debian. Вроде проблем не было. Описание что переделано вложил в архив. Пока писал всё это, вышло чёт дофига. Нареканий, для себя, пока не встречал. Но если вдруг у кого что упадёт то попробую поправить.
- Вложения
-
EsetUPDtool_25112025.zip- (155.81 КБ) 94 скачивания
-
uNseen
- проходил мимо
- Сообщения: 5
- Зарегистрирован: 2025-11-25 4:49:40
шустрый скрипт скрипт зеркала NOD32
Всем привет.
Настроил скрипт от скорпа, все работает, антивирус обновляется. Классная штука!
Есть вопросительный момент.
У меня endpoint 12-ой версии. В конфиге скрипта выставил значение: versionep12 = 1
При работе скрипта консоль также выдает лог, что идет обновление версии ESET NOD32 Endpoint Ver. 12:
В логе выше, например, показано какая версия баз сейчас "у нас", и какая версия баз на зеркале. Соответственно, до этой версии обновится и мой EP. Но при этом на странице выпуска обновлений ESET часто есть и более новые версии:

https://help.eset.com/updates/?utm_sour ... ontent=ees
Вопрос: это обновления для каких-то других версий? Или их просто еще нет на зеркале, откуда я скачиваю обновления(что было бы странным). Или же надо в конфиге выставить доп опции? Все же скрипт ищет и скачивает базы в соответствии со своим конфигом, и закралась мысль, что может скрипт просто "недокачивает" из-за своих настроек.
Настроил скрипт от скорпа, все работает, антивирус обновляется. Классная штука!
Есть вопросительный момент.
У меня endpoint 12-ой версии. В конфиге скрипта выставил значение: versionep12 = 1
При работе скрипта консоль также выдает лог, что идет обновление версии ESET NOD32 Endpoint Ver. 12:
Код: Выделить всё
[2025-11-28 15:00:01] [ep12] Обновляем вериию: ESET NOD32 Endpoint Ver. 12
[2025-11-28 15:00:02] [ep12] В хранилище update.ver версии : 32264.0 /var/www/nod32mirror2/eset_upd/ep12/dll/update.ver
[2025-11-28 15:00:02] [ep12] Скачиваем файл update.ver
[2025-11-28 15:00:02] [ep12] Сохраняем update.ver в : /opt/pynod-mirror-tool/pynod-mirror-tool/tmp/update.ver
[2025-11-28 15:00:02] [ep12] update.ver: 0%| | 0.00/220k [00:00<?, ?B[2025-11-28 15:00:02] [ep12] update.ver: 100%|##########| 220k/220k [00:00<00:00, 2.51MB/s]
[2025-11-28 15:00:02] [ep12] Версия баз у нас : 32264.0
[2025-11-28 15:00:02] [ep12] Версия баз на зеркале: 32266.0
https://help.eset.com/updates/?utm_sour ... ontent=ees
Вопрос: это обновления для каких-то других версий? Или их просто еще нет на зеркале, откуда я скачиваю обновления(что было бы странным). Или же надо в конфиге выставить доп опции? Все же скрипт ищет и скачивает базы в соответствии со своим конфигом, и закралась мысль, что может скрипт просто "недокачивает" из-за своих настроек.
-
depositaire
- сержант
- Сообщения: 202
- Зарегистрирован: 2011-10-14 14:04:17
-
uNseen
- проходил мимо
- Сообщения: 5
- Зарегистрирован: 2025-11-25 4:49:40
шустрый скрипт скрипт зеркала NOD32
depositaire, Буквально пару дней как запустил. Если разрыв в 1-2 версии это частое явление, то я спокоен и понаблюдаю.
-
depositaire
- сержант
- Сообщения: 202
- Зарегистрирован: 2011-10-14 14:04:17
-
uNseen
- проходил мимо
- Сообщения: 5
- Зарегистрирован: 2025-11-25 4:49:40
шустрый скрипт скрипт зеркала NOD32
Расписание у меня каждые 3 часа, но когда я увидел, что версии разнятся, то попробовал запускать скрипт в ручную, и он все равно на зеркале видел только отстающую версию. Может и правда дело в зеркале, откуда я тяну обновления? В качестве зеркала в настройках стоит "узбекский" сервер.depositaire писал(а): ↑2025-11-28 18:43:30А расписание то какое поставили? если там у вас 2 раза в день то это норма явно. Даже если 4 раза в день и то можно попасть между 2мя версиями.
-
depositaire
- сержант
- Сообщения: 202
- Зарегистрирован: 2011-10-14 14:04:17
-
uNseen
- проходил мимо
- Сообщения: 5
- Зарегистрирован: 2025-11-25 4:49:40
шустрый скрипт скрипт зеркала NOD32
depositaire, Да
-
depositaire
- сержант
- Сообщения: 202
- Зарегистрирован: 2011-10-14 14:04:17
-
uNseen
- проходил мимо
- Сообщения: 5
- Зарегистрирован: 2025-11-25 4:49:40
шустрый скрипт скрипт зеркала NOD32
Почему сразу "что-то хочу"? У меня появились сомнения, было ли дело в моем конфиге или в чем-то другом, и я вполне прозрачно и адекватно описал суть вопроса. Без претензий и хотелок.depositaire писал(а): ↑2025-11-28 20:08:55Эм, ну так простите что вы тогда хотите? Хоть устанавливайте раз в час получение с этого сервера.
Понятно, так и предполагал. Наверное, их сервер так настроен во избежание бана.depositaire писал(а): ↑2025-11-28 20:08:55Если там настроено что качать 1-2 раза в день то удивляться разрыву и нечего
-
zxpn5
- рядовой
- Сообщения: 10
- Зарегистрирован: 2025-11-19 7:50:22
шустрый скрипт скрипт зеркала NOD32
Всем привет, подскажите, а локально по сетке у всех (у кого есть) проходят обновы?
Просто хотелось бы с расшаренного диска, офлайн обновы по сети раздавать, и не поднимать еще в придачу вебсервер, ну по крайней мере пока) На компах сейчас в основном 12 еав
Просто хотелось бы с расшаренного диска, офлайн обновы по сети раздавать, и не поднимать еще в придачу вебсервер, ну по крайней мере пока) На компах сейчас в основном 12 еав
-
depositaire
- сержант
- Сообщения: 202
- Зарегистрирован: 2011-10-14 14:04:17
шустрый скрипт скрипт зеркала NOD32
Я конечно извиняюсь, просто чуточку поразил ваш вопрос.
Лучше поднять nginx и будет вам мир и спокойствие) Да ещё и логи легче ловить если у кого что-то не пашет. А ставить там пару нажатий мышкой)
-
scorp337150
- мл. сержант
- Сообщения: 121
- Зарегистрирован: 2020-02-24 8:40:47
шустрый скрипт скрипт зеркала NOD32
Всем привет, я с нова с вами, по здоровью было как-то совсем не до скрипта.
Из того, на чем остановился - скрипт на стадии внедрении режима хранения баз в одной папке для возможности обновлений не через веб сервер, а при помощи указания папки, функция для многих востребованная, подумываю на счет гибридного хранения баз - часть баз под веб сервер, часть под обновление из папки с настройкой через конфиг. В общем, скрипт не застыл.
Из того, на чем остановился - скрипт на стадии внедрении режима хранения баз в одной папке для возможности обновлений не через веб сервер, а при помощи указания папки, функция для многих востребованная, подумываю на счет гибридного хранения баз - часть баз под веб сервер, часть под обновление из папки с настройкой через конфиг. В общем, скрипт не застыл.
-
zxpn5
- рядовой
- Сообщения: 10
- Зарегистрирован: 2025-11-19 7:50:22
шустрый скрипт скрипт зеркала NOD32
scorp337150, по поводу локально из папки прям тоже можно...
-
Angel79
- рядовой
- Сообщения: 39
- Зарегистрирован: 2012-12-05 7:51:33
шустрый скрипт скрипт зеркала NOD32
Всем привет, сегодня обратил внимания что мой антивирь перестал обновляться и у себя на сервере вижу вот такую красоту...
18 версия перестала качать обновления.
Код: Выделить всё
v16 32300.0 0 1157 1.4 GB 1152 2025-12-05 00:03:49 2025-12-05 00:03:50 1155 1.4 GB
v18 403 Client Error: Forbidden for url: http://um21.eset.com/auto/consumer/windows/dll/update.ver
-
scorp337150
- мл. сержант
- Сообщения: 121
- Зарегистрирован: 2020-02-24 8:40:47
шустрый скрипт скрипт зеркала NOD32
Angel79, Приветствую, видимо связано с тем, что у них основная стала v19. Сейчас на виртуалке гляну куда антивирус лезет за обновлением и сегодня выйдет апдейт "как есть" с юзер агентом и файлами init под v19 и не до конца оттестированной функцией скидывания баз в одну паку, чтоб можно было обновлять антивирусы из папки без веб сервера
-
depositaire
- сержант
- Сообщения: 202
- Зарегистрирован: 2011-10-14 14:04:17
шустрый скрипт скрипт зеркала NOD32
Там кажись этот путь auto/consumer/windows/dll/update.ver для всех новых версий. Если я не путаю ничего.
-
scorp337150
- мл. сержант
- Сообщения: 121
- Зарегистрирован: 2020-02-24 8:40:47
шустрый скрипт скрипт зеркала NOD32
Встречайте новое обновление скрипта https://github.com/Scorpikor/pynod-mirror-tool !
+ В конфиг nod32ms.conf в раздел [LOG] добавлена возможность определять путь и имя лог файла в параметре log_file_path
+ В конфиг nod32ms.conf в раздел [ESET] добавлен параметр mode_one_dir_base, который включает режим хранения баз в одной папке с update.ver, для возможности обновления баз клиентов из папки без использования веб сервера
+ В user_agent.py добавил более свежие агенты актуальных антивирусов, которые были у меня
depositaire, Спасибо тебе за идеи, подсмотрел у тебя манипуляции с лог файлом, свой код тоже чуть "переосмыслил"
Как всегда всем спасибо за наводки, идеи и тесты
+ В конфиг nod32ms.conf в раздел [LOG] добавлена возможность определять путь и имя лог файла в параметре log_file_path
+ В конфиг nod32ms.conf в раздел [ESET] добавлен параметр mode_one_dir_base, который включает режим хранения баз в одной папке с update.ver, для возможности обновления баз клиентов из папки без использования веб сервера
+ В user_agent.py добавил более свежие агенты актуальных антивирусов, которые были у меня
depositaire, Спасибо тебе за идеи, подсмотрел у тебя манипуляции с лог файлом, свой код тоже чуть "переосмыслил"
Как всегда всем спасибо за наводки, идеи и тесты
-
БлагоЯр
- проходил мимо
- Сообщения: 3
- Зарегистрирован: 2025-12-01 16:27:01
шустрый скрипт скрипт зеркала NOD32
Где бы ещё адресок для обновы взять, уже весь интернет перелопатил. Те что вроде как рабочие выдают ошибки (я так понял с другими путями наверное что-то).scorp337150 писал(а): ↑2025-12-05 20:55:40Встречайте новое обновление скрипта https://github.com/Scorpikor/pynod-mirror-tool !
-
scorp337150
- мл. сержант
- Сообщения: 121
- Зарегистрирован: 2020-02-24 8:40:47
шустрый скрипт скрипт зеркала NOD32
Где взять сервер для обновы - это, конечно, отдельная тема, а какие ошибки скрипт выдает - возможно проявит причины. Только, если выкладываете лог, постарайтесь "замаскировать" как-то сервер, с которого обновляетесь, чтоб владельцам не подкидывать проблем. Ну и как альтернативный вариант, можно купить ключ
-
БлагоЯр
- проходил мимо
- Сообщения: 3
- Зарегистрирован: 2025-12-01 16:27:01
шустрый скрипт скрипт зеркала NOD32
Хорошая шутка.
Например
[2025-12-06 00:09:28] Запущен скрипт 20250619
[2025-12-06 00:09:28] Режим обновления с неофициальных зеркал (конфиг init.py)
[2025-12-06 00:09:28]
[2025-12-06 00:09:28] [ep12] Обновляем вериию: ESET NOD32 Endpoint Ver. 12
[2025-12-06 00:09:28] [ep12] В хранилище update.ver версии : 32307.0 /var/www/html/esetupd.somedomain2.org/eset_upd/ep12/dll/update.ver
[2025-12-06 00:09:28] [ep12] Сохраняем update.ver в : /root/pynod/tmp/update.ver
[2025-12-06 00:09:29] [ep12] Не удалось обновить версию с 32307.0 до версии 0
[2025-12-06 00:09:29] [ep12] Ошибка скачивания баз версии
[2025-12-06 00:09:29] [ep12] Причина: Ошибка подключения: 404 Client Error: Not Found for url: http://eset.somedomain.ru/dll/update.ver
[2025-12-06 00:09:29]
-
scorp337150
- мл. сержант
- Сообщения: 121
- Зарегистрирован: 2020-02-24 8:40:47
-
depositaire
- сержант
- Сообщения: 202
- Зарегистрирован: 2011-10-14 14:04:17
шустрый скрипт скрипт зеркала NOD32
Да там у меня какой-то неадекватный полёт фантазии был) Ещё под конец прикрутил отправку сообщений в почту. И да, чисто моё мнение, но очистку я думаю стоит и тебе добавить. Всё таки через месяц другой байда ещё та с папками. Последнее время я заметил что офф. сервера стали менять названия папок. Хз это связано с разными серверами или там админам скучно. Но каждый день одна из версий перекачивает всю папку по новой. Пару дней полежит и опять может поменять название.
